Synchronisation multi‑appareils : comment les meilleurs sites de jeux offrent une expérience de machine à sous fluide pour bien commencer la nouvelle année

Les fêtes de fin d’année sont le moment où les joueurs passent naturellement du smartphone dans le train, à la tablette du salon, puis au PC de bureau pour profiter d’une session de slots plus confortable. Cette mobilité implique que chaque appareil doit retrouver instantanément le même solde, les mêmes bonus et la progression d’une partie entamée ailleurs. Sans une synchronisation fiable, le joueur risque de perdre des crédits, de voir un bonus expiré ou de devoir recommencer un tour qui était déjà en cours, ce qui fragmente l’expérience et décourage la fidélité.

Pour découvrir d’autres astuces de jeux responsables, visitez https://www.placedumarche.fr/.

Dans la suite, nous identifierons d’abord les problèmes de fragmentation des sessions, puis nous détaillerons les solutions techniques adoptées par les plateformes de slots les plus performantes, en passant par l’architecture serveur‑client, la sécurité des portefeuilles, le cloud gaming, le cache côté client, l’UX optimisée, des cas pratiques et enfin une checklist prête à l’emploi.

1. Le problème de la fragmentation des sessions de jeu

Les premières plateformes de casino en ligne fonctionnaient en mode « stand‑alone » : chaque appareil hébergeait son propre moteur de jeu et stockait les crédits localement. Avec l’avènement du cloud, les opérateurs ont pu centraliser les données, mais beaucoup de sites n’ont pas encore migré complètement, créant une fracture entre les sessions locales et celles hébergées.

Cette fracture se traduit concrètement par la perte de crédits lorsqu’un joueur passe de son iPhone à son iPad, ou par la disparition d’un bonus de bienvenue qui était actif uniquement sur le navigateur de bureau. Selon une étude interne de l’industrie, près de 27 % des joueurs abandonnent leur session pendant les périodes festives dès qu’ils rencontrent un problème de synchronisation, préférant passer à un concurrent plus fluide.

Le problème s’accentue avec les promotions de Nouvel An, où les jackpots progressifs et les tours gratuits sont souvent limités dans le temps. Un joueur qui commence un tour gratuit sur son téléphone et qui doit changer d’appareil pour profiter d’un bonus de dépôt risque de voir ce tour expiré s’il n’est pas correctement synchronisé.

En résumé, la fragmentation génère trois effets néfastes : perte de valeur perçue, augmentation du taux d’abandon et réduction du temps moyen de jeu, autant de facteurs qui nuisent à la rentabilité des casinos français en ligne.

2. Architecture serveur‑client : le socle de la synchronisation

Le modèle client‑serveur repose sur un serveur central qui conserve l’état du joueur (solde, bonus, progression) et sur un client léger qui ne fait qu’afficher les graphismes et envoyer les actions du joueur. Deux technologies clés assurent la fluidité : les API REST pour les requêtes ponctuelles (connexion, récupération du solde) et les WebSocket pour le flux continu des événements de jeu (spins, gains, mise à jour du RTP).

Un exemple typique : le joueur appuie sur « Spin » sur son smartphone, le client envoie un message via WebSocket contenant l’identifiant de session et le pari. Le serveur calcule le résultat, met à jour le portefeuille et renvoie un paquet contenant le nouveau solde, le gain et l’état du bonus. En même temps, le même serveur pousse ces informations aux autres appareils connectés au même compte via leurs propres canaux WebSocket, garantissant que la tablette et le PC affichent immédiatement le même résultat.

Cette architecture minimise la latence perçue, car le calcul reste côté serveur, et assure que chaque appareil travaille avec une source de vérité unique, éliminant ainsi les incohérences de données.

3. Gestion sécurisée des identités et du portefeuille de jetons

La synchronisation ne peut être fiable que si l’identité du joueur est correctement authentifiée. La plupart des sites de casino en ligne utilisent OAuth 2.0 pour déléguer l’autorisation, combiné à une authentification à deux facteurs (SMS ou application d’authentification) afin de protéger l’accès au compte. Une fois le token JWT délivré, il porte les droits d’accès et une durée de vie limitée, ce qui empêche les interceptions prolongées.

Les soldes et les gains sont chiffrés en transit (TLS 1.3) et au repos (AES‑256). Cette double couche de cryptage empêche les tentatives de « double‑spending », où un joueur tenterait de réclamer le même gain depuis deux appareils simultanément. Le serveur maintient un verrou logique sur chaque transaction : dès qu’une mise est acceptée, le portefeuille est débité et le statut de la transaction passe à « en cours ». Toute autre tentative de dépense du même solde est rejetée jusqu’à ce que le serveur confirme le résultat du premier appareil.

En pratique, un joueur qui joue à Starburst sur son PC et, quelques secondes plus tard, lance Gonzo’s Quest sur sa tablette verra le serveur refuser le second pari si le premier n’est pas encore finalisé, évitant ainsi les incohérences de crédit.

4. Le cloud gaming et le streaming de slots : une nouvelle frontière

Le cloud gaming décale le rendu graphique du client vers le serveur. Au lieu de télécharger le moteur de la machine à sous, le joueur reçoit un flux vidéo 1080p en temps réel, tandis que les entrées (clics, touches) sont renvoyées au serveur. Cette approche supprime les différences de puissance matérielle entre les appareils et garantit que chaque session utilise exactement le même environnement de jeu.

Les avantages sont multiples : la latence perçue diminue parce que le serveur pré‑calcule les résultats et les envoie immédiatement, la sauvegarde de l’état est instantanée (le serveur possède déjà la dernière image du jeu) et la continuité entre appareils devient transparente. Des fournisseurs comme AWS GameLift ou Google Cloud Gaming offrent des instances dédiées à faible latence, capables de gérer des pics de trafic pendant les promotions du Nouvel An.

Un casino français qui propose le streaming de Mega Moolah pourra ainsi offrir le même jackpot progressif à un joueur sur mobile et sur PC, sans que celui‑ci doive télécharger le même fichier SWF ou HTML5 plusieurs fois.

5. Cache côté client et stratégies de récupération d’état

Même avec un serveur central, le client conserve temporairement des données pour améliorer la réactivité. IndexedDB et LocalStorage permettent de stocker la dernière position du joueur, le solde affiché et les paramètres de mise. Lors d’un re‑login, le client effectue une « state rehydration » : il charge d’abord les données locales, puis interroge le serveur pour valider et mettre à jour les informations.

Exemple de flux de re‑hydration

  1. Le joueur ouvre l’application sur sa tablette.
  2. Le client lit le solde de LocalStorage (par exemple 12,45 €).
  3. Une requête API REST récupère le solde officiel (12,47 €).
  4. Le client ajuste l’affichage et conserve les 2 cents de différence comme « delta » à appliquer.

Lorsque deux appareils modifient simultanément le même compte, le serveur applique une résolution de conflits basée sur le timestamp et le numéro de séquence de chaque transaction. Le client qui reçoit une mise à jour « out‑of‑order » affiche une notification indiquant que le solde a été ajusté, évitant ainsi toute confusion.

6. Optimisation UX : notifications, sauvegarde auto et reprise instantanée

Une bonne expérience utilisateur repose sur des rappels clairs et des points de reprise visibles. Les pop‑ups de reprise de partie s’affichent dès que le serveur détecte une session inachevée sur un autre appareil : « Vous avez laissé Book of Dead à 3 spins du jackpot ? Reprenez maintenant ! ».

Les rappels de bonus non réclamés sont synchronisés via le même canal WebSocket, de sorte que chaque appareil montre le même compteur de temps restant. Un tableau comparatif montre l’impact des notifications sur le taux de réengagement pendant les campagnes du Nouvel An.

Plateforme Taux de réengagement (%) Temps moyen de reprise (s)
Site A 42 3,2
Site B 35 5,1
Site C 48 2,7

Des tests A/B menés sur 10 000 joueurs ont révélé que les notifications push combinées à une sauvegarde auto augmentent le temps moyen de jeu de 18 % et le revenu moyen par utilisateur de 12 % pendant les 48 heures qui suivent le réveillon.

7. Cas pratiques : comment trois sites de slots leaders implémentent la sync

  • Site A utilise une architecture micro‑services : un service dédié aux sessions, un autre aux portefeuilles, le tout stocké dans une base NoSQL (MongoDB). La réplication en temps réel assure que chaque appareil reçoit les mises à jour via Kafka.
  • Site B adopte une approche hybride : un SDK mobile intégré qui gère la connexion WebSocket et le cache local, tandis que le backend REST assure la persistance. Cette solution permet de fonctionner même avec une connexion intermittente, en re‑syncronisant dès que le réseau revient.
  • Site C mise tout sur le full‑cloud : les jeux sont streamés en 1080p depuis des instances GPU sur Google Cloud, la sauvegarde d’état est instantanée grâce à Firestore. Les joueurs bénéficient d’une reprise en moins d’une seconde, même après un redémarrage complet de l’appareil.

Les leçons pour les opérateurs plus modestes sont claires : choisir entre micro‑services et SDK selon les ressources, garantir une réplication fiable des données et prévoir un fallback local pour les connexions faibles.

8. Checklist technique pour lancer votre propre solution multi‑appareils

Côté serveur
– API REST versionnées, sécurisées par OAuth 2.0.
– WebSocket avec reconnexion automatique et keep‑alive.
– Base de données transactionnelle ou NoSQL avec réplication en temps réel.
– Mécanisme de verrouillage des transactions pour éviter le double‑spending.

Côté client
– SDK intégré (iOS, Android, Web) supportant JWT et rafraîchissement de token.
– Cache IndexedDB pour la dernière position et le solde.
– UI de reprise de partie avec notifications push.
– Tests de charge simulant 10 000 connexions simultanées pendant le pic du Nouvel An.

Tests indispensables
– Scénario de changement d’appareil en plein spin.
– Simulation de perte de connexion et de reconnection.
– Vérification de la cohérence des soldes après 100 000 transactions simultanées.

En suivant ces points, même un petit casino en ligne pourra offrir une expérience sans couture, comparable aux géants du secteur.

Conclusion

Une synchronisation fluide transforme chaque session de machine à sous en une aventure continue, quel que soit l’appareil utilisé. Les joueurs restent plus longtemps, reviennent plus souvent et dépensent davantage, surtout pendant les pics saisonniers comme les promotions du Nouvel An.

Même si la mise en place technique demande du temps et des ressources, la checklist présentée décompose le projet en étapes claires et progressives. Les opérateurs qui déploient ces solutions avant la nouvelle année pourront annoncer fièrement leurs nouvelles fonctionnalités de sync, offrant ainsi aux joueurs un critère décisif : la continuité sans faille.

Pour approfondir les bonnes pratiques du jeu responsable ou découvrir d’autres ressources utiles, n’hésitez pas à consulter Placedumarche, qui propose des guides pratiques et des liens vers des outils de gestion de compte.

Leave a Reply

Your email address will not be published. Required fields are marked *